Provide one example of a CRISPR-Cas application for biotechnology.

검증된 단계별 안내
1
Understand that CRISPR-Cas is a powerful genome editing tool that allows precise modification of DNA sequences in living organisms.
Identify a key application of CRISPR-Cas in biotechnology, such as gene editing to improve crop traits, develop disease-resistant plants, or create genetically modified organisms (GMOs).
Consider an example like using CRISPR-Cas to knock out a gene responsible for susceptibility to a plant disease, thereby enhancing the plant's resistance.
Explain how the CRISPR-Cas system targets a specific DNA sequence using a guide RNA and introduces a cut, which the cell repairs, leading to the desired genetic change.
Summarize the application by highlighting its impact, such as increased crop yield, reduced pesticide use, or improved nutritional content.

CRISPR-Cas System

The CRISPR-Cas system is a natural adaptive immune mechanism found in bacteria that can be engineered to target and edit specific DNA sequences. It uses a guide RNA to direct the Cas nuclease to a complementary DNA sequence, enabling precise gene editing.

Gene Editing in Biotechnology

Gene editing involves making targeted changes to an organism's DNA to alter its traits. In biotechnology, this allows for the development of genetically modified organisms with improved characteristics, such as disease resistance or enhanced productivity.

Applications of CRISPR-Cas

CRISPR-Cas technology is applied in biotechnology for purposes like creating disease-resistant crops, developing gene therapies for genetic disorders, and engineering microbes for biofuel production. These applications demonstrate its versatility and impact.
